Background Technology

[0002] Metal ball joints (also known as metal ball hinges) are, as the name suggests, ball hinges or ball joints made of metal materials; they consist of a spherical component (center) and a spherical shell (bowl); their main feature is that they are made of metal to create a pair of joints that can move spherically together. Because they are made of metal materials, they have high load-bearing capacity and are durable; they are now widely used in various industries.

[0003] There are currently two main structures for metal ball joints. One type directly encases the ball core with a cup, while the other separates the cup and core into inner and outer sleeves. The inner surface of the outer sleeve matches the inner sleeve to achieve smooth spherical rotation, forming a ball head. This ball head is then fitted onto other housings and spindles to form various joint components. Because the latter method is more flexible, its application is becoming increasingly widespread. For example, metal ball joints play an indispensable role in V-shaped thrust rods in heavy-duty trucks, primarily preventing forward and backward displacement of the middle and rear axles, as well as lateral displacement. However, in applications with large vertical swing radius, this type of inner-outer sleeve metal ball joint can experience vertical movement of the inner and outer sleeves within the joint. This not only accelerates wear on the metal ball joint assembly, leading to a decline in overall assembly performance and a significantly reduced service life, but also easily generates noise when it first begins to loosen. Therefore, improvements are necessary.

[0004] The search revealed no identical technical reports, only technical literature in related fields. The most similar articles are as follows:

[0005] 1. Patent No. CN201880055244.6, entitled "Central Joint for Three-Point Linkage", applicant: ZF Friedrichshafen AG, invention patent, which discloses a central joint with an anti-disengagement mechanism, the central joint having a housing that is rotatable and swingable by a ball joint relative to the axial connection of the central joint. The central joint also has an anti-disengagement mechanism that acts as a stop. This anti-disengagement mechanism extends perpendicularly to the central axis of the shaft connection and prevents the separation of the housing and the shaft connection in the event of ball joint failure. The patent discloses a typical flange-type metal ball joint structure. In the patent document, the inner and outer sleeves of the ball head are respectively fitted onto the spindle of the mandrel or inside the housing. The inner sleeve is simply fitted onto the spindle of the mandrel with a tight fit, while the outer sleeve is press-fitted into the ball head outer sleeve hole of the housing. Although there is a retaining ring in the figure, there is no textual description. It can be understood as an ordinary axial retaining ring for the hole. This structure not only makes the inner sleeve prone to loosening during operation but also easily leads to loosening under severe bumps. Although the patent proposes an anti-disengagement mechanism at the top, the vertical movement in the initial loose state cannot be eliminated, which will cause a lot of noise during operation. The outer ring is said to have an axial retaining ring, but if it is an ordinary axial retaining ring, there will also be axial clearance, which can also easily cause the outer sleeve to move up and down in the hole of the housing, generating a lot of noise.

[0006] 2. Patent document DE112006000910T5 discloses a flange-type metal ball joint structure. This metal ball joint lacks effective axial stops in both its inner and outer sleeves, relying solely on a central joint anti-disengagement mechanism, constructed as a transverse lock, referred to as a stop element. The central joint has a ball-and-socket joint and is connected to a rigid shaft. The transverse lock is oriented only in the lateral direction of the vehicle; that is, only in a single spatial direction. While this provides room for movement, preventing the transverse lock from colliding with adjacent components, especially under strong compression and / or rebound motion of the rigid shaft when the central joint's structural height is low, this approach sacrifices the safety of central joint separation if the transverse lock is used as a stop after the connection between the inner and outer rings of the ball-and-socket joint becomes loose. In this case, separation of the central joint can only be prevented jointly by the two ends of the transverse lock when there is no swaying deflection angle in the central joint. Conversely, if the central joint deflects due to swaying motion, the chassis force attempting to disengage the central joint must be absorbed entirely by the single end of the transverse lock. If this single effective end of the transverse lock, which prevents central joint disengagement, bears additional load beyond the normal operating loads during driving, such as due to a special event like running over a curb, it may bend completely or even break. Such a shortened transverse lock can no longer prevent disengagement because it is more likely to detach from the central joint during further driving, thus failing to solve the aforementioned problem.

[0007] 3. Patent No. CN200720062370.3 discloses a metal ball joint for automobile suspension, including two riveted ball heads, one V-shaped ball head, two sleeves, and a flange mounting seat. One end of each of the two sleeves is connected to a riveted ball head, and the other end is connected to a V-shaped ball head. The riveted ball head is a pin-type rubber joint structure, and the V-shaped ball head is a pin-hole type rubber joint structure. The metal ball joint, with riveted ball heads, V-shaped ball heads, and sleeves assembled via hot riveting, uses pin-type and pin-hole type rubber joints, which are axially pre-compressed into the riveted ball heads and V-shaped ball heads respectively. Washers are used to adjust the pre-compression of the rubber joints, thus adjusting their stiffness. Elastic retaining rings are used to prevent the rubber joints from axially dislodging. A flange mounting seat is bolted to a V-shaped ball head mounting seat on the drive axle. The flange mounting seat, with a 1:10 taper, engages with the conical surface of the pin-hole type rubber joint at the V-shaped ball head end, allowing for rotation and oscillation within a certain angle and torque, facilitating the transmission of forces in various directions. However, this technical solution still relies solely on ordinary axial retaining rings to limit the axial position of the outer sleeve, and the aforementioned problem of vertical movement still exists.

[0008] All of the aforementioned patents relate to engine mounts and propose structural improvements to automotive mounts. Among them, CN201880055244.6 is the closest technical solution, but none of these improved technical solutions have effectively solved the problem of axial movement of the inner and outer sleeves of the metal ball joint during operation; therefore, further research and improvement are still needed. Detailed Implementation

[0032] The present invention will now be described in detail with reference to the accompanying drawings and specific embodiments. Example 1

[0033] This embodiment is an axial clearance elimination device for a metal ball joint with an inner and outer sleeve structure. The inner spherical sleeve 1 of the metal ball joint head 8 is press-fitted into the metal ball joint housing 2, and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 is press-fitted onto the ball head mandrel 4. The bottoms of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 are respectively restricted and positioned by the inner hole step 5 of the metal ball joint housing 2 and the lower step 6 on the ball head mandrel 4. Axial clearance elimination devices 7 are respectively provided on the upper part of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3. The axial compensation of the axial clearance elimination devices 7 eliminates the axial clearance of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 within the metal ball joint housing 2 and on the ball head mandrel 4, preventing axial movement of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 during operation.

[0034] The axial clearance elimination device 7 eliminates the axial clearance of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 within the metal ball joint housing 2 and on the ball head spindle 4 by pressing the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 into the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and onto the ball head spindle 4, respectively. The lower parts of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 are respectively limited by steps within the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and on the ball head spindle 4. Further steps are provided within the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and on the ball head spindle 4 at the upper part of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3. An axial clearance elimination device 7 is provided, which is equipped with a self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 that can adjust the axial position. The self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is obliquely inserted into the groove provided in the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and the ball head spindle 4 in a self-locking manner. The axial position is adjusted by the depth of oblique insertion into the groove, thereby eliminating the clearance between the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 and the upper part of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3, and preventing the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 from making noise due to the clearance with the retaining ring during operation.

[0035] Furthermore, the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10, which is used to obliquely engage with the grooves on the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and the ball head spindle 4, consists of wide grooves 9 cut into the ball head spindle 4 and the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 at the upper part of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3, respectively. The width of the wide grooves 9 is greater than the thickness of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10. The upper surfaces of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 are inserted into the wide grooves 9, and then the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is obliquely engaged with the wide grooves 9 at a radial self-locking angle. As the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is radially engaged with the wide grooves 9, self-locking occurs. The elastic compensating stop 10 moves downward axially simultaneously until the lower end face 11 of the self-locking elastic compensating stop 10 is tightly against the upper end face of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3, thereby eliminating the clearance between the self-locking elastic compensating stop 10 and the upper end face of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3; and if any clearance exists between the self-locking elastic compensating stop 10 and any upper end face of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 during operation, the self-locking elastic compensating stop 10 will quickly move inward under the action of its own elastic force, and at the same time, compensate and eliminate the existing clearance axially downward; thus completely avoiding noise during operation.

[0036] The process of inserting the upper surfaces of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 into the wide groove 9 involves ensuring that, when the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 are respectively installed on the ball head mandrel 4 or the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2, the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 are tightly attached to the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and the step on the ball head mandrel 4, and that the upper surfaces of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 are higher than the width of the wide groove 9 on the ball head mandrel and the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2. The lower end face 12 of the groove allows the upper end faces of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 to extend into the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and the inner surface of the wide groove 9 on the ball head spindle, leaving space for the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 to move downward. Once there is a clearance between the upper end faces of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 and the lower end face of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10, the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 can continue to extend into the inner surface of the wide groove 9, and at the same time, the lower end face of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 can also move axially downward.

[0037] The upper surfaces of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 are higher than the inner hole of the metal ball joint housing 2 and the lower end surface 12 of the wide groove 9 on the ball head spindle. The upper surfaces of the inner spherical s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 protrude into the wide groove 9 by a height H, where H is 0.5-1.5mm; preferably H is 0.8-1mm. The required downward distance can be calculated based on the machining errors and wear clearances that may occur during operation, combined with the slope of the self-locking inclined surface, and the height H is reserved.

[0038] The self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is inserted into the wide groove 9 at a radial self-locking angle. This means the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 and the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 are in oblique contact, and the angle of this contact is a radial self-locking angle. This ensures that the radial component of the force on the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 and the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is always less than the radial elastic force of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10. This keeps the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 in a radially self-locking state, preventing it from automatically withdrawing radially. It is important to note that this point requires careful attention. If the angle is too small, the radial travel of the self-locking elastic compensation stop within the wide groove will be very long, resulting in a deep penetration of the wide groove into the outer shell or mandrel, which will affect the strength of the outer shell or mandrel. Conversely, if the angle is too large, the self-locking elastic compensation stop may fail to self-lock, easily disengaging radially, and requires a large inward elastic force.

[0039] The oblique contact between the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 and the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 means that at least one part of the upper end face of the wide groove 9 and the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is a self-locking oblique surface relative to the axis of the main ball seat, while the other upper end face is an arc surface 17. The contact between the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 and the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is a contact between the oblique surface and the arc surface, and the radius of curvature of the arc surface 17 must be greater than 6mm. The contact angle between the oblique surface and the arc surface is the self-locking angle, that is, radial self-locking relative to the axis 15 of the main ball seat. In this way, the contact between the arc surface and the oblique surface can facilitate the insertion of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10, reduce frictional resistance, and maintain self-locking.

[0040] Furthermore, the contact between the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 and the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is an inclined surface and an arc-shaped surface. This means that the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 is an inclined surface arranged obliquely to the axis of the main ball seat. This ensures that when the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is engaged in the wide groove 9, the arc angle of the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 makes oblique contact with the inclined surface of the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9, and ensures that the arc angle of the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 is in contact with the wide groove 9. The normal force direction 19 of the contact point 18 of the inclined surface of the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 forms a radial self-locking angle with the axis of the main ball seat; as the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 extends into the wide groove 9, the lower end face of the stop of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 gradually moves downward until it hits the upper end face of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3, eliminating the clearance between the upper end face of the inner spherical outer sleeve 1 and the outer spherical inner sleeve 3 and the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10, ensuring that the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 will not come out of the wide groove 9 on its own during vehicle operation.

[0041] Furthermore, the self-locking angle α is the angle between the normal force direction of the upper end face 13 of the wide groove 9 and the upper end face 14 of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 in oblique contact with the axis of the ball head, with an angle value of 5-14 degrees; preferably, 8-12 degrees is the best; when it is greater than 14 degrees, it is difficult to achieve self-locking, and the stability of the self-locking elastic compensation stop 10 will be greatly affected.
